Before tagging the Quillport release, confirm every third-party font vendored under `third_party/fonts/` matches the checksums recorded in `FONTS.lock`. Any mismatch blocks the release; do not regenerate the lockfile without legal review of the font licenses, as redistribution terms vary. Once checksums pass, the font bundle is folded into the main artifact and signed as a single unit — never sign fonts separately. The release manager then verifies the assembled artifact against the current signing key, shown below.

deploy key for kajof-fajop: bky6_gDHw9Q

Handover: Marit to Deshawn, for the release manager's sign-off. The Quillkit shared component library now follows strict semver enforced by the publish pipeline; any breaking prop change without a major bump fails CI. Consumers pin to a minor range, and the canary channel publishes nightly prereleases. Release notes are generated from commit trailers. The publish service currently runs with the configuration values listed here.

deployment values, kajep-kageg:
[praix]
host = praix.paliqcorp.corp
user = praix_svc
database = praix_prod

**Q: Level 4 is finally opening — what do we need to know?**

A: Good news, yes! From next Monday, level 4 of Copperfield Wharf is live, including the new huddle rooms and the coffee point everyone's been asking about. The main lifts will serve the floor from 07:00, and cleaning crews get early access from 05:30. Normal badges work on the lift, but the service corridor behind the kitchenette stays restricted for now. If you need to get in there for resets or deliveries, use the code below.

badge for fafop-fajof: bdg-Z-47

Runbook: `shrinkray` CLI batch-resizes images for the Lumenfold asset store. For review: run it against the fixtures dir first, check output dims, and don't skip the dry-run flag — it's saved us twice. Resulting artifacts should match the reference build, identified by the token below.

pipeline stamp: htk31_f769b577b3028a4e9958e5bb8d1259a